Back in the USA, Donald finally became the star of his own newspaper comic strip. The Donald Duck daily strip started on February 2, 1938, and the Donald Duck Sunday page began December 10, 1939. Taliaferro drew both, this time co-operating with writer Bob Karp. He continued to work at the daily strip until October 10, 1968, and at the Sunday ...
Mr. Duck Steps Out is a Donald Duck cartoon produced by Walt Disney Productions, which is released on June 7, 1940, and featured the debut of Daisy Duck. [1] The short was directed by Jack King and written by Carl Barks , Chuck Couch, Jack Hannah , Harry Reeves, Milt Schaffer, and Frank Tashlin .
Donald Duck, also known as Donald Duck and Friends, is an American Disney comic book series starring the character Donald Duck and published by various publishers from October 1942 to June 2017. As with many early Disney comics titles, Donald Duck began as individual issues of Dell Comics ' Four Color one-shots series.

Articles relating to Donald Duck, a cartoon character created by The Walt Disney Company. Donald is an anthropomorphic white duck with a yellow-orange beak, legs and feet. He typically wears a sailor shirt and cap with a bow-tie. Donald is known for his semi-intelligible speech and his mischievous, temperamental, and pompous personality.
Fethry Duck is the son of Lulubelle Loon and Eider Duck (a son of Grandma Duck) and is the beatnik cousin of Donald Duck. He was created for the Disney Studio Program by Dick Kinney and Al Hubbard and was first used in the story "The Health Nut", published on August 2, 1964.
